Average Performance Engineer with Performance Analysis Skills Salary in Australia

Annual Base Salary - $128,136.00/year

The average annual salary of Performance Engineer is $128,136.00

The starting salary of Performance Engineer is between $64,260.00 and $75,600.00 whereas the maximum salary range is between $156,600.00 and $180,090.00.

Performance Engineer Salary Comparison by Gender

Female
Male

This pie chart demonstrates the gender share for Performance Engineer. As indicated, the golden colour represents the percentage share for women and the green represents the percentage share for men.

As shown in the chart, male employees are involved significantly more as Performance Engineer compared to female. Their involvement is 74% while of female is only 26%.

Salary Distribution Based on Years of Experience

The line graph shows Performance Engineer salary in Australia on an annual basis. In this graph specifically, it is indicated that as the years of experience increases, so does their wages.

For 5-9 years, the Performance Engineer salary increases to $124,873.04

After reaching the 10-19 year experience in their career, another increase in salary will be added to a total of $130,629.88.
